I’d made it about 18 months without buying a keeper gun and had actually liquidated a good many . But about two weeks ago I bought the Parker NH 10 gauge 34” . Well today I was offered a Parker EH 10 gauge 28” factory original gun of which I already have one . As I talked to the guy selling it we found my gun and this gun he offered me were consecutive serial number both made in 1891 to the same dealer . So I know have the pair .
